作品介绍:
该作品是一个简单的图形界面程序,利用EasyX图形库在Windows环境下进行开发。程序的主要功能是初始化一个指定大小的窗口,并在这个窗口中绘制一个红色的矩形条,同时在矩形的正中央显示一串黄色的数字文本。
详细解释与代码分析:
-
头文件引入:
#include<stdio.h>:标准输入输出库。#include<graphics.h>:EasyX图形库,用于图形绘制。#include<string.h>:字符串处理库。#include<conio.h>:控制台输入/输出库,但在此代码中并未使用。#include<math.h>:数学库,但在此代码中并未使用。#include<time.h>:时间库,但在此代码中并未使用。
-
宏定义:
- 定义了窗口的高度
WIN_HEIGHT和宽度WIN_WIDTH(注意,WEITH可能是的拼写错误)。 - 定义了绘图的起始坐标
INTERVAL_X和INTERVAL_Y。 - 定义了填充矩形的高度
FILL_HEIGHT。
- 定义了窗口的高度